RSRM Associate Participates in Civics and Law Program at a Local Baltimore City High School

On December 19, 2013 RSRM Associate Tara A. Barnes participated in a Civics and Law program at Patterson High School in Baltimore City, Maryland.  The program was sponsored by the Maryland State Bar Assocation and the Bar Association of Baltimore City.

Legal professionals including the Honorable JoAnn Ellinghaus Jones, Carroll County District Court, Honorable Pamila J. Brown, Howard County District Court and several practicing attorneys in various fields presented lessons, activities and discussion on topics including Rights and Responsibilities, Free Speech and School Speech, Power and Empowerment and Law in a Cyber Age.

Tara Barnes, Judge Ellinghause Jones and Assistant State's Attorney Sidney Butcher presented a program on Law and Justice.  This program enabled students to examine the nature and function of law in American society, explore the ideals of justice, due process, burden of proof, and the many factors that influence judging and sentencing in criminal cases.

The legal professionals also participated in a panel discussion where they discussed their roles and responsibilities, and provided helpful advice to students interested in pursuing a career in law.

The Civics and Law program was  a huge success and exposed High School students to many important aspects of law.  Local media, including WBAL was present and included a segment on this program.
